Congratulations to Bonsoiree’s Shin Thompson and Luke Creagan for being invited to host a dinner at the James Beard Foundation in New York City on October 12th. This is Thompson’s second trip to the Beard House. Heralded as a “genius” in a recent 3-star raving review from the Chicago Tribune, Thompson hosted a similar site-specific culinary performance in NYC in 2009.
Showcasing seasonal cuisine that supports local artisans, Bonsoiree in Logan Square, has revolutionized the BYOB experience by inviting guests to sample award-winning area vintners. French-Japanese fusion plates are masterfully put together with extreme attention paid to color, shape, texture and functionality. Four-, seven-
and thirteen-course tasting menus are available.
Thompson, chef and owner, finds inspiration from his upbringing in Honolulu and Japan. He infuses traditional Japanese methods with classic French techniques to create complex flavors that arouse the senses. Originally opened in 2006 as a small gourmet café and delicatessen, a year later, Thompson modified the concept to what Bonsoiree is today.
Chef de Cuisine Creagan grew out of a little different mold. Raised in Muskego, Wisconsin, his culinary career started at Culver’s, followed by Arlington Park’s Breeder’s Cup, the W Hotel, and Soldier Field before joining the team at Bonsoiree.

Also be sure to sign up for Bonsoiree’s exclusive Underground Dining events. Derived from private dinner parties hosted by Bonsoiree’s founding chefs, the purpose of these dinners was to expose people to what has become known as the Bonsoiree culinary style. These invitation-only Saturday evening dinner events involve a six-course tasting menu exclusive to that month and chef service for every guest.
